{"library":"graphql-amqp-subscriptions","type":"library","category":null,"description":"Implements the PubSubEngine interface from graphql-subscriptions using AMQP (RabbitMQ) as the pub/sub mechanism. Current stable version is 3.0.1, targeting graphql@16.x and graphql-subscriptions@3.x. Maintained since 2017 with periodic updates. Key differentiator vs alternatives like graphql-redis-subscriptions: it reuses existing amqplib connections and channels, offers flexible exchange/queue configuration, and supports topic exchanges for pattern-based routing.","language":"javascript","status":"active","version":"3.0.1","tags":["javascript","graphql","subscription","api","push","pull","amqp","rabbitmq","rabbit","typescript"],"last_verified":"Sun Jun 07","install":[{"cmd":"npm install graphql-amqp-subscriptions","imports":["import { AMQPPubSub } from 'graphql-amqp-subscriptions'","import AMQPPubSub from 'graphql-amqp-subscriptions'","import { AMQPPubSubOptions } from 'graphql-amqp-subscriptions'"]},{"cmd":"yarn add graphql-amqp-subscriptions","imports":[]},{"cmd":"pnpm add graphql-amqp-subscriptions","imports":[]}],"homepage":"https://github.com/Surnet/graphql-amqp-subscriptions","github":"https://github.com/Surnet/graphql-amqp-subscriptions","docs":null,"changelog":null,"pypi":null,"npm":"graphql-amqp-subscriptions","openapi_spec":null,"status_page":null,"smithery":null,"compatibility":null}